MMK's steel product shipments up 2.4 percent in Q1

Thursday, 17 April 2014 15:58:04 (GMT+3)   |  
       

Russian steel producer Magnitogorsk Iron and Steel Works (MMK) has stated that in January-March this year it shipped around 2.7 million mt of steel products by rail to Russian and foreign customers, up 2.4 percent compared to the same period of last year. 1.65 million mt of shipments went to the domestic market, up 2.8 percent, while export shipments totaled 965,000 mt, increasing by 1.8 percent, both year on year.
